Experience the emotional and inspiring tale of Robert Pardon as he recounts his journey from hopelessness to recovery in this captivating episode of The Recovery Guy Podcast. Robert, a self-proclaimed 'happy, grateful, recovered alcoholic,' shares his personal story, beginning with his introduction to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) in Las Vegas back in 1986.
With humour and honesty, Robert discusses the turning points that led him to sobriety, including the moment he realised he was at rock bottom and the pivotal role AA played in his recovery. Listeners will find themselves drawn into Robert's world as he describes the camaraderie and support he found in the AA community, which helped him rebuild his life. Robert also touches on the importance of honesty in recovery and the challenges he faced in admitting his alcoholism.
His story is a testament to the transformative power of surrendering control and embracing the principles of AA. With over 39 years of sobriety, Robert offers a wealth of wisdom and encouragement for anyone on their own recovery journey.
